Cost v Convenience. Only you can really determine which is for you.

The transport is awesome, free, regular and does what it says on the tin.
But, say you want to be at a Park from 8.00am until 5.00pm, head back to your Resort, change then head out for a meal at a Resort location and back to your Resort at circa 10.00pm. Nightmare!
You will be waiting around for the specific bus, hoping you can get on and its not already packed, if wet you will be freezing in the air con and very late back to your room.
Not for me but I do accept it can work.

first trip we were off site hired a car the whole time 21 days, used it every day
second trip 21 days on site, hired a car for middle week, no bargains to be found anywhere.
next trip - planning 14 days on site, wont hire car, Uber if we need to go anywhere off site.

DME, Disney busses are ace.

footnote - if Disney cant move our dates back we will hire a car to go to the coast for the first 4 days, but I wouldn't hire one if I was onsite again.
